BUAP inaugurates Casa de la Reina cultural space and hosts literary event
The Benemérita Universidad Autónoma de Puebla (BUAP) has expanded its cultural offerings with the inauguration of Casa de la Reina and a literary presentation by Mario Iván Martínez.
Rectora Lilia Cedillo Ramírez inaugurated Casa de la Reina, a new cultural space designed to foster artistic development among students and the general public. Located at Avenida Reforma 913, the facility will offer workshops in painting, engraving, and dance, including salsa, bachata, and cumbia. The venue also features reading areas, a cinema, and a gallery showcasing ceramic work by sculptor Gustavo Tanús.
Additionally, actor and writer Mario Iván Martínez presented a collection of children's stories at the BUAP Bookstore within the Complejo Cultural Universitario (CCU). The collection features tales inspired by the childhoods of historical figures such as Leonardo da Vinci,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art, Vincent van Gogh, Sor Juana Inés de la Cruz, and Francisco Gabilondo Soler. The presentation aimed to encourage reading habits among younger generations by humanizing these iconic figures through storytelling.
